Nokatgre Population - East Garo Hills, Meghalaya

Nokatgre is a medium size village located in Resubelpara Block of East Garo Hills district, Meghalaya with total 37 families residing. The Nokatgre village has population of 216 of which 111 are males while 105 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Nokatgre village population of children with age 0-6 is 44 which makes up 20.37 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Nokatgre village is 946 which is lower than Meghalaya state average of 989. Child Sex Ratio for the Nokatgre as per census is 1000, higher than Meghalaya average of 970.

Nokatgre village has higher literacy rate compared to Meghalaya. In 2011, literacy rate of Nokatgre village was 89.53 % compared to 74.43 % of Meghalaya. In Nokatgre Male literacy stands at 92.13 % while female literacy rate was 86.75 %.

Caste Factor

In Nokatgre village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 98.61 % of total population in Nokatgre village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Nokatgre village of East Garo Hills.

Work Profile

In Nokatgre village out of total population, 148 were engaged in work activities. 60.81 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 39.19 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 148 workers engaged in Main Work, 86 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
